I think you need a 4013 that is a single stack to make a 1013 but I really don't know for sure. The TSW is a double stack.

Yup- The 8-shot early 4013 (and the rare-ish 4014) were built on a single-stack .45 frame and used modified 10XX mags (shorter length with a cartridge OAL gap spacer). These guns can be converted to 10 mm in a straight forward process. The later 9-shot 4013 are built on a 69XX size frame, and can't go to 10mm.
